Analysis
In 2025, asylum-seekers by country or territory of origin, per capita in IDA blend stood at 0.0003 units per person.
The figure is down 31.0% on the previous year and down 6.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, asylum-seekers by country or territory of origin, per capita in IDA blend peaked at 0.0005 units per person in 2024 and was at its lowest, 0.0001 units per person, in 2000.
That places IDA blend 36th out of 45 groups with data for 2025,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Asylum-seekers by country or territory of origin divided by Population, total, mat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Asylum-seekers by country or territory of origin ÷ Population, total
Computed from
- Asylum-seekers by country or territory of origin Refugee Population Statistics Database, UN High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R)
- Population, total World Population Prospects, United Nations (UN)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
